Warburg Pincus-backed Full Sail IP Partners has acquired the rights to the Odwalla food and beverage brand from The Coca-Cola Company, as it looks to revive the brand after the soft drinks giant discontinued it last year.
According to Reuters, Odwalla is the first acquisition Full Sail IP Partners has made since its launch as a joint venture between Warburg Pincus and brand licensing specialists LMCA.
Founded in 1980, Odwalla offered plant-based fruit juices, smoothies and energy bars.
“We’re thrilled that Odwalla, with its long history of innovation, high levels of brand awareness and reputation for great products, will be our first acquisition,” said Full Sail’s CEO, Alan Kravetz.
“We look forward to providing consumers with the best tasting, artfully crafted functional beverages and foods to allow them to snack well, feel well and live well.”
Terms of the deal were not disclosed.
